2013 Career Camp

 
2013 Career Camp Registration This Week!
 
June 17th-20th, from 9am-2pm.
 
Any current 8th or 9th grader can participate in the 5th Annual Career Camp, hosted by Hanover High School and South Western High School.  The camp is free of charge, with all transportation and lunch provided.  The goal of the camp is to expose students to the wide variety of career pathways that exist in Hanover and York, as well as application and interview skills for the future.  See the attached brochure for more information, or contact: Mr. David Harnish;  Transition Coordinator, Hanover High School: dharnish@hanoverpublic.org; (717) 637-9000, x318.

Hanover Area Association of Retired Teachers recognizes Bonnie Naill and Jim McMahon

HAART

Jim McMahon and Bonnie Nail were recognized at a luncheon this week at the York Fair grounds. Each year the Hanover Area Association of Retired Teachers recognizes a professional staff member and support staff member from one of four area schools that go over and beyond the call of duty. Jim is a reading specialist at HMS and Bonnie is a teaching assistant working primarily with the ELL students at HHS. Both have done an outstanding job this year and have made a tremendous impact on many students.

MS Students Participate in York College Nitrogen Experiments

YCNitrogenExperiments

Students from the York College (chemistry society) and Professor Halligan, recently visited 6th grade at the Middle School and conducted liquid nitrogen experiments. A few of the experiments conducted were freezing and smashing balloons, flowers, and bananas, making ice cream and learning about ideal gas laws.
